A house design with no hallways may be more efficient at using space. Hallways are used to move from room to room, but it may be possible in a small house to have related rooms next to each other, so that hallways are unnecessary.

You can think of the endoplasmic reticulum in a cell as a system of hallways and rooms for transporting and modifying molecules. Similarly, in a house, you can use hallways and rooms to move and process items. Just as the endoplasmic reticulum is crucial for protein production in cells, rooms in a house can be designated for specific tasks, like a kitchen for cooking or a study for working. Both the endoplasmic reticulum and a house's layout serve as organized systems for efficient functions.
